West Ham want £80m for Mateus Fernandes

Fernandes is set to leave West Ham after their relegation to the Championship.

West Ham need to raise £100m from player sales as a result, and it could be argued that the former Sporting CP midfielder is their most valuable asset.

Arsenal are keen on adding Fernandes to their Premier League title-winning squad, but United have also identified the Portugal international as Carrick looks to revamp his midfield.

According to Ben Jacobs, West Ham value Fernandes at approximately £80m because they want double what they paid to Southampton (£38m + £4m).

The journalist adds that Fernandes does not have a relegation release clause, but he is expected to be sold before the start of the new season.

Jacobs stresses that West Ham need to make £100m in sales this summer, so United and other potential suitors will test their resolve in the transfer market.

West Ham are bound to search for the best deal they can get, but clubs like Arsenal and United won’t want to overpay for the 21-year-old star.

United are willing to pay around £50m for Fernandes, which is significantly less than what West Ham are currently demanding.

Fernandes was left out of the Portugal squad for the 2026 World Cup, but a deal could drag on unless West Ham accepts that £80m is too high a valuation.

Man Utd’s previous signing from West Ham

The last senior player United signed from West Ham was Carlos Tevez.

The 2007 transfer was complex due to the third-party ownership issues, as well as the Argentine striker’s controversial decision to jump from United to Man City.
